On March 15, 2024 at approximately 11:15am,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Ly conducted an unannounced, case management inspection for lead testing in Child Care Center's water. LPA met with the Executive Director, Anne Kwong and Site Supervisor, Janet Lui and Site Supervisor, Jenny Huang . The purpose of the inspection was explained. Children were at the park when LPA arrived. Children returned to facility at noon. Present today were 5 staff caring for 21 children.

LPA discussed the new Assembly Bill (AB) 2370, Chapter 676, Statutes of 2018 requires the Lead Testing of water in the Child Care Center with the site director during the inspection. All Child Care Centers that are located in buildings constructed before January 1, 2010, must have their water tested and post the results by January 1, 2023, and every 5 years after the date of the first testing.

Per report collected from facility, facility had conducted lead testing in January 2020. However, lead testing was not done according to Written Directive. On this day, facility has been advised to retest. Per facility representatives, facility has been scheduled for retest 03/21/2024. Facility did not conduct lead testing based on the requirement of the Written Directive poses a potential health and safety risk to children in care. Type B deficiency has been issued on this day in accordance with the Health and Safety Code 1597.16(a)(1), see LIC 809D.

Plans of Corrections (POC) were developed and reviewed with Executive Director. A copy of this report and appeal rights were discussed and left with Executive Director whose signature on this form confirm receipt of these reports.

(1) A licensed child day care center, as defined in Section 1596.76, that is located in a building that was constructed before January 1, 2010, shall have its drinking water tested for lead contamination levels on or after January 1, 2020, but no later than January 1, 2023, and every five years after the date of the initial test.
